Origin of the Amundsen Surname

The Amundsen surname is of Scandinavian origin (Old Norse). In the 2010 U.S. Census it ranked #16,203 with 1,782 Americans (0.6 per 100K people).

Ethnic Distribution of Amundsen

Among 1,782 Americans named Amundsen, the largest self-reported group is White (94.61%).
